From fdb36a364c5b82bed7b2568d6620b807f32560d0 Mon Sep 17 00:00:00 2001 From: Ian Gulliver Date: Tue, 30 Dec 2025 12:30:44 -0800 Subject: [PATCH] Send Stripe receipt email to donors --- main.go | 3 +++ 1 file changed, 3 insertions(+) diff --git a/main.go b/main.go index d9581cd..0736f29 100644 --- a/main.go +++ b/main.go @@ -270,6 +270,9 @@ func createCheckoutSession(eventID, email string, amountCents int64) (string, er params := &stripe.CheckoutSessionParams{ CustomerEmail: stripe.String(email), Mode: stripe.String(string(stripe.CheckoutSessionModePayment)), + PaymentIntentData: &stripe.CheckoutSessionPaymentIntentDataParams{ + ReceiptEmail: stripe.String(email), + }, LineItems: []*stripe.CheckoutSessionLineItemParams{ { PriceData: &stripe.CheckoutSessionLineItemPriceDataParams{